Heart Smart Bisquick Impossible Pies

I've read about the ladies who have had difficulty with Heart Smart Bisquick pancakes and biscuits. I love the Heart Smart mix! When I use it, I just pretend it is the original mix and the end product is delicious.


However, that said, I am nervous about making Impossible Pies with Heart Smart because so many of the recipes call for the original mix.  Are the mixes interchangable in Impossible Pies or is there a posting where I can find the pie recipes made with the Heart Smart mix?

Yes, Cate, that's the one.


 Last night, I made two pies - one for my husband and me and one for my grandkids (7,13,16). For veggies I used an organic mix from my garden (cauliflower, broccoli & carrots) and traded the Swiss cheese for Muenster..


They were terrific! Both my husband and my grands loved them. Now my grandsons are looking forward to the cheeseburger and the taco versions!
